个人学习MySQL应该购买阿里云哪种服务器进行搭建?

个人学习MySQL:选择阿里云哪种服务器更合适?

结论

在个人学习MySQL的过程中,选择一款适合的服务器至关重要。对于初学者和小型项目,阿里云提供了多种类型的服务器供我们挑选,包括基础版ECS、轻量级的云数据库RDS MySQL以及更高级的弹性计算服务。这里将根据个人需求、预算和项目规模,探讨哪一种阿里云服务器最适合用于MySQL的学习与实践。

详细分析

  1. 基础版ECS(弹性计算服务)
    如果你是初级用户,或者主要用于个人学习和小规模实验,基础版ECS是一个不错的选择。它提供了一台完整的虚拟服务器,你可以自行安装和配置MySQL。这种灵活性让你有机会深入理解数据库的底层运作,包括磁盘管理、网络配置等。然而,基础版ECS可能需要你自行维护系统安全和性能优化,对于新手来说,初期可能需要投入更多时间学习。

  2. 云数据库RDS MySQL
    对于希望专注于数据库管理,而不是服务器运维的新手,阿里云RDS MySQL是个理想选择。RDS提供了预置的高性能环境,无需担心硬件维护和性能调优。你只需关注数据库的配置和使用,适合快速上手和专注于业务逻辑开发。但请注意,RDS可能不支持所有高级特性,如分区、复制等。

  3. 更高阶的弹性计算服务
    如果你的项目规模逐渐扩大,或者你想探索更复杂的数据库应用场景,可以考虑使用阿里云的更高阶产品,如Serverless数据库或ESSD云硬盘增强型实例。这些服务通常提供更高的并发处理能力和更好的I/O性能,但成本也会相应增加。它们适合有一定技术基础,对性能有较高要求的开发者。

综合考量

在决定时,你需要考虑以下几点:

  • 项目需求:你的项目规模和复杂度,是否需要高可用性、备份恢复等功能。
  • 学习目标:你希望通过学习掌握哪些MySQL知识,是基础操作还是高级特性。
  • 预算:不同的服务有不同的计费模式,长期来看,可能需要根据实际使用情况选择最经济的方案。
  • 技术支持:阿里云提供了丰富的文档和教程,但如果你是初学者,可能需要更全面的技术支持。

结论重申

总的来说,对于个人学习MySQL,基础版ECS是一个好的起点,它能提供实践平台。如果追求便捷和专注业务,RDS MySQL是个不错的选择。而由于项目发展,你可能需要考虑升级到更适合的弹性计算服务。最重要的是,根据自己的需求和学习进度,灵活选择阿里云的服务器产品,以最大化学习效果。

未经允许不得转载:秒懂云 » 个人学习MySQL应该购买阿里云哪种服务器进行搭建?